William Timothy King

William Timothy King (Lester's father) was the sixth born child of the Philip King family.  He was born on November 16,1874 in Tiffin, Ohio.  He came to Iowa at the age of eight with his parents where they settled on a farm.  His entire life occupation was farming.  He was married to Frances Jacobi Boddicker on April 17, 1906 at St Marys Catholic Church in Cedar Rapids, Iowa.  The couple made thier home near there for a year before moving to a farm south of Brooklyn, Iowa.  There they spent most of 22 years, except for two short periods when due to the ill health of William, they were forced to rent the farm and made their home in South Dakota, Marengo and Brooklyn. 

Frances Jacobi (Lester's mother) was the daughter of Joseph and Therese Wrede Jocobi.  She was born in Brilon, Germany on November 8, 1876.  Her father Joseph was born in Brilon, Germany on April 8, 1847.  He was married to Therese Wrede, also of Brilon, and to this union, six children were born in the fatherland (Germany).  In 1877, the family came to America.  Frances was but six months old.  They settled in Iowa County, Iowa.  There, six more children came to bless their home.  The family occupation was farming in Marengo, Iowa.
